ASPCA Pet Health insurance is offered by the Hartville Group, Inc. ASPCA (American Society for the prevention of cruelty to animals) has a long history and was America’s first animal welfare organization.
ASPCA Overview
It started fighting animal cruelty in 1866 when it was founded by Henry Bergh to provide support for the prevention of cruelty to animals throughout the United States. Today, this humane society has more than 1 million supporters across the country. As pet insurance is an important tool to support pet parents in affording medical care for their pets, ASPCA chose Hartville, one of the oldest and largest pet insurance providers in the US, as its strategic partner for pet insurance. Hartville is committed to pet health and to upholding the ASPCA’s standards for the humane treatment of animals.
Underwriter
Underwritten by the United States Fire Insurance Company. The Hartville Group, Inc. provides pet insurance through its subsidiary, Petsmarketing Insurance.com Agency, Inc.. Pet insurance plans are offered through three different brand names: ASPCA Pet Health Insurance, Hartville Pet Insurance, and Petshealth Care Plan. Offered in all 50 states and the District of Columbia.

What is covered?:
Hartville/ASPCA offer four different level of protection for cats and dogs. All four levels offer a reimbursement of 90% of all vet bills. Dogs must be at least 8 weeks-13 years old to enroll. Cats must be at least 8 weeks – 15 years old.
Level 1 includes:
• Ongoing Conditions (e.g. allergies, cancer or diabetes)
• Unexpected Accidents
Level 2 includes above, plus:
• Illnesses
Level 3 includes all of the above, plus
• Hereditary and congenital diseases
• Alternative therapies
• Behavioral treatments
Level 4 includes all of Level 3’s benefits, plus:
• Higher benefits
Moreover, wellness coverage may be added to Level 3 and 4 plans. These can routine wellness procedures (e.g. wellness exams, spay/neuter treatments, vaccines and dental treatments) or advanced wellness procedures (provides same as routine wellness procedures, but allows higher claims).
Are pre-existing conditions covered?:
Pre-existing conditions are not covered. If pre-existing conditions are considered curable and the last treatment for this condition was over 180 days ago, the condition might be covered.
What is not included in plans?:
• Pre-existing conditions
• Inhumane treatment
• Breeding
• Pregnancy
• Grooming
• Special foods or nutritional supplements
• Alternative therapies
• Foreign object ingestions (if more than once per policy term)
• Dental injuries (unless resulting from accident or injury)
Any Vet?:
Any vet can be used.
Policy Duration:
12 months.
Deductible:
Annual Deductibles $100.
Pricing:
Starts at $10.00/months. Price depends on level chosen, breed, location, age, etc. Plans don’t have a maximum or lifetime payout, but have maximum incident payouts depending on the level. The Level 2 Incident Limit is $3,000, for the Level 3 Incident limit is $5,000 and the Level 4 Incident limit $7,000. Annual benefit limit: $13,000 and the Co-Pay: 10%. Additional Information:
They also dedicated to other programs such as animal poison control which helps pet owners if their pets ingest toxic substances. They’ve also established spay/neuter clinics, pet loss support services, an Animal Behavior Center and the Bergh Memorial Animal Hospital. Moreover, the ASPCA supports programs which put an end to unnecessary euthanasia of adoptable pets and fights for any kind of pet-positive national legislation. Includes a 30-day trial.
